Finding Your Niche
Choosing the right niche is crucial for your blogging success. Consider the following steps to identify your niche:
- Assess your interests: What topics are you passionate about?
- Research market demand: Use tools like Google Trends to see what people are searching for.
- Analyze competition: Check existing blogs in your potential niche to understand the landscape.

Monetizing Your Blog
Now that you have traffic, it’s time to monetize your blog. Here are some effective methods:
- Affiliate Marketing: Promote products related to your niche and earn commissions on sales.
- Sponsored Posts: Collaborate with brands to create content in exchange for payment.
- Ad Networks: Use platforms like Google AdSense to display ads on your blog.
